All Categories
Featured
Table of Contents
The essential principles to be covered while prepping for coding interviews consist of arrays, strings, recursion, hash tables, trees, graphs, dynamic programming, and arranging algorithms. To help you toenail coding meetings at the biggest firms, Meeting Kickstart uses 13 coding meeting prep work programs.
Throughout this moment, you can schedule simulated interviews, 1-on-1 coach sessions with sector specialists, and therapy sessions with our very skilled occupation trains. Interview Kickstart's team of extremely qualified instructors are existing hiring supervisors and participants of the hiring committee at FAANG+ companies. Our trainers are closely associated with the meeting process at top companies, providing our pupils a substantial edge over the competitors.
I would love to introduce myself as the most recent member of the Effect Interview group. I have actually been prompted to give some professional guidance to those of you encountering the prospect of experiencing a technical meeting. I've remained in the software program field for the last 7 years and am presently an engineering manager at More significantly, nonetheless, throughout my occupation I have actually been constantly thinking about technological interviews and have had a wide range of experience resting on both sides of the table.
The bulk of candidates I speak with end up not obtaining job deals due to the fact that they screw up some technological section of the meeting. Most of these instances, nonetheless, it has nothing to do with the knowledge or capacity of the prospects, however instead their absence of ideal preparation for a technical interview.
This question generally proves to be a stumper, yet if correct trouble solving strategies are utilized it comes to be a lot extra convenient definitely not easy, yet convenient. Off, you need to recognize that the 1MB demand is merely a made up number. For problems similar to this that have big data collections, it's alluring to begin by taking a look at the big picture, yet that's not truly the method you intend to solve them.
If you've refined one integer and afterwards are asked to return a number randomly, what do you require to do? Well, that's easy, you need to return the one number that you've seen with 100% likelihood. What happens if you've seen 2 numbers? You'll return the very first number with 50% possibility or the 2nd with 50% probability.
For each number that you check out from the stream you'll need to roll an N sided pass away to choose whether that becomes your new return number or not, if it is then you can fail to remember whatever the old return number was and keep the new one in its location. For the very first number you see you'll have a 1/1 likelihood of making that your return number.
I'll leave it as a workout to the reader to draw up the inductive evidence to show that this really functions, yet that's the solution. Keep in mind that this isn't an especially excellent interview question as it calls for some particular probability understanding to address. I've seen it asked before, and it aids highlight that having a good strategy to problem solving can mean the difference in between floundering on an inquiry and at the very least making affordable development.
The trick is out: great deals of work prospects are doing meeting training to get an advantage. If you've got a meeting showing up, you're most likely asking on your own: what is a meeting trainer, and should I hire one? It's challenging since there are lots of interview mentoring services available, with significant variations in prices that sometimes birth little connection to the top quality of the coaching.
We have actually likewise classified them for various demands and specialties. Meeting coaching is where you function with a professional trainer to increase your opportunities of exciting in a work interview and landing a task deal.
If they have actually operated in your sector, they can offer you particular insights into what your job interviewers will certainly be looking for. One of the most usual layout for the coaching session is a mock meeting. Your trainer will certainly play the duty of the recruiter and ask you the kind of concerns that you're preparing for.
After conducting a mock interview with you, your trainer should be able to zoom in on your weaker locations and offer you extremely workable, certain responses that you can eliminate and utilize to enhance your performance. Some prospects like to utilize meeting mentoring to evaluate their readiness levels. They after that adapt their interview preparation appropriately.
This way, you can either go into your interview packed with self-confidence or take the required actions to boost while you have left. Rather than booking a session with an interview coach as a "dress wedding rehearsal" for the real thing, you could pick to use a train earlier on in your prep work process.
Evidently, 93% of people really feel anxious before a work meeting. Unless you are just one of the 7% with ice in their veins, you'll need to discover a way to manage nerves, stay tranquil, and project self-confidence. The more you practice something, the much less demanding it needs to come to be, so mock meetings with a trainer can really help in reducing anxiousness.
Also often, meeting processes at huge companies are sluggish and rather opaque and serves however has its restrictions. If you really want some insight from a person who's been on the within of the procedure, book an interview coach that has actually run meetings at the business you're interviewing for.
You can make use of usual frameworks to structure your solutions. The majority of individuals use the Celebrity technique for responding to behavioral concerns (though we believe that the SPSIL technique is far better). A meeting coach can show you the pertinent response structures that relate to your meetings. Demonstrating good interaction abilities is crucial to acing an interview.
They should also be able to give you pointers on your non-verbal communication. Some meeting coaches also use return to evaluation solutions, where instead of running a mock meeting they'll take the time to go through your return to and identify areas for improvement.
At the top end, exec mentoring plans begin at around $500 and run right into the thousands. Various factors impact what you might pay for interview mentoring: The type of know-how the instructors have actually and how specialized they are Just how good the site is (e.g.
The secret is to make certain you're obtaining worth for money.
The short response is: yes, most likely. Let's take an appearance at exactly when it is worth the investment, and when it's probably best to pass. Thousands of applicants apply for each open setting, and you can do rather well in your meetings and still not make the cut.
If you're intending to obtain a job at a leading firm, you'll possibly have to go via several meetings. And you will not be able to depend on a smile and a solid resume - you'll require to offer terrific response to hard inquiries, over and over. In this context, anything you can do to improve your meeting abilities and come close to the interviews with confidence makes a whole lot of sense.
From a totally economic point of view, why wouldn't you spend a couple of hundred bucks on meeting mentoring to boost your chances? Practically everybody obtains at least a little bit nervous before job meetings, yet some individuals obtain so stressed out that they can't give an excellent account of themselves.
Table of Contents
Latest Posts
Comprehensive Overview to Software Program Engineering Meetings Just how to Plan For Software Engineer Meetings Successfully Software Designer Meeting Preparation Program Leading Software Application
Comprehensive Guide to Software Program Engineering Interviews Just how to Plan For Software Program Engineer Interviews Properly Software Engineer Meeting Prep Training Course Top Software Design Man
Comprehensive Overview to Software Program Design Meetings Just how to Get Ready For Software Program Designer Meetings Efficiently Software Application Designer Meeting Preparation Course Leading Sof
More
Latest Posts